THE EMPIRE, TAXES AND TREASON � Roman domination ≈ 70 years � Taxation through locals who worked for Rome � Chief Tax Collectors / Regular Tax Collectors � A collector was to be avoided at all costs � Could tax a man for what he was carrying � Traded social acceptance for RICHES - extorsion � Labeled as TRAITORs of the worst kind

  8. JERICHO � One of the earliest settlements - 9000 BC � Eden of Palestine / Palm Trees � About 29km from Jerusalem � Different climate – Herod’s Winter Palace � Wealthy / Beggars � Estimated population > 10,000

  14. CONFRONTING IDOLATRY � ZACCHAEUS’ LIFE WAS RULED BY GREED � IT LED HIM TO BETRAY HIS COUNTRY � WEALTH AND MONEY WERE HIS IDOLS � CHRIST DID NOT LET THAT SIT! � NO RECORD OF WHAT WAS SAID, BUT... � HIS INTERACTION WITH JESUS WAS SO INTENSE THAT HE TOOK IMMEDIATE ACTION AGAINST HIS IDOLS.

  17. WARREN WIERSBE’S OUTLINE � 19:2-4 - A Man Became a Child (ran down the street like a little child"), � 19:5 - A Seeking Man Became Found; � 19:7-8 - A Small Man Became Big; � 19:9-10 - A poor man became rich

  18. ME, YOU AND ZACCHAEUS � WE ARE ALL TRAITORS � IDOLATRY BATTLE FOR OUR HEARTS � OBSTACLES KEEPING US FROM CHRIST � CHRIST DRAWS US NEAR / CHRIST CALLS US � RICHES AND POWER CAN’T SAVE US � WE MUST CRUSH THE IDOLS OF OUR HEARTS � REPENTANCE MUST BE VISIBILE � NEVER TOO LATE TO TURN TO CHRIST
